**Handover — Marsfield Franchise Deal**

Hi Odile — handing you the Bramwick franchise agreement mid-stream. Terms are mostly settled: seven-year term, royalty steps in year three, fit-out costs shared. Finance still needs to model the guarantee clause before we sign anything. Keep Lenn in the loop on cash timing. The confidential note on the surrounding business plans follows directly below.

management briefing: Silethax Systems plans to raise the Holix list price by 50.2 percent in December. The steering committee signed off on a budget of $329.9 million for Project Holok. The renewal with Juldorax Foods closes at $278.2 million a year, 54.3 percent above the last contract. Project Briir slips by one quarter because of the supplier delay.

Handover before the sync: the Florin conversion service accumulates rounding drift when chaining conversions through the base currency. Root cause is truncation instead of banker's rounding in the intermediate step. Patch is drafted; needs a decision on whether to backfill affected ledgers. Please raise it Wednesday. Ongoing ownership of this fix sits with the engineer named below.

account owner for bawip-tahag: Raleth Quenok

- [ ] **Step 7: Breaker override escrow.** After sealing the signing keys for the Tallgrove upstream API circuit breaker, confirm the support team can force the breaker open during a full outage. The override bundle lives in the sealed escrow drawer and is useless without its unlock phrase. Two ceremony witnesses must initial this step before proceeding. The escrow bundle is decrypted with the recovery passphrase that follows.

vault phrase of kahip-kahop = holath-quenmir